8.3.3 Use a 3-mm hexagonal key with 3 mm to firmly screw in the screws 3 (Fig. 39) in
the threaded holes in the clamping beam, causing the false clamp to be locked in the
clamping beam.
8.3.4 Release the pressure on the pedal 2 (Fig. 39) - the beam with the inserted cylinder
returns to the upper position
The removable false clamp must be attached under the front table!
(Fig. 38).
INFO
The lack of the insert in the place of attachment is treated by the programmer as if it was
mounted in the clamping beam and narrow cut (waste) is greater.
Mounting the insert into the pressure bar causes: the minimum narrow cut (waste) is
40mm (without insert 22mm), maximum stack height is 76mm (without 80mm insert).
